Andy Serkis Declares Video Games Art, Equating Them to Film and Stage

Andy Serkis, known for his acting roles, has stated that video games should be considered art. He believes there is no fundamental difference between playing video games and acting in films or on stage. Serkis's comments come as the video game industry has grown significantly, surpassing other entertainment sectors. AI
